1 Commission d'Éthique
L'un des trois organes juridictionnels de la FIFA, qui est régi par le Code d'éthique de la FIFA tel qu'établi par le Comité Exécutif de la FIFA.One of FIFA's three judicial bodies whose function is governed by the FIFA Code of Ethics as established by the FIFA Executive Committee.Dictionnaire Français-Anglais (UEFA Football) > Commission d'Éthique

3 Commission de Recours
Organe juridictionnel de la FIFA compétent pour examiner les recours interjetés contre des décisions de la Commission de Discipline.The higher instance of the FIFA judicial bodies, responsible for hearing appeals against Disciplinary Committee decisions.Dictionnaire Français-Anglais (UEFA Football) > Commission de Recours

5 Commission de Discipline
Commission de Discipline f FIFAOrgane juridictionnel de la FIFA compétent pour prononcer des mesures disciplinaires contre des associations membres de la FIFA, des clubs, des officiels, des joueurs, des agents organisateurs de matches et les agents de joueurs en cas d'infraction à la réglementation de la FIFA.The lower instance of the judicial bodies of FIFA, authorised to deal with breaches of FIFA regulations by FIFA member associations, clubs, officials, players, match agents and players' agents.Dictionnaire Français-Anglais (UEFA Football) > Commission de Discipline

6 Règlement disciplinaire
Règlement disciplinaire m UEFARèglement édicté par le Comité exécutif de l'UEFA, qui décrit la procédure disciplinaire et les règles disciplinaires de l'UEFA.Regulations issued by the UEFA Executive Committee setting out procedures for the administration of justice and disciplinary codes.Dictionnaire Français-Anglais (UEFA Football) > Règlement disciplinaire
